Seasonal Update

July was killer heat and the hills show it.August cooled off and little or no rain here in Chianti. The grapes are small, it will be interesting to see if little water raised the sugar content and hence a fabulous year for small but high quality production. La Notte di San Lorenzo

August 10th is the San Lorenzo’s day. Saint Lawrence, San Lorenzo, was martryed by being grilled to death. The story goes that as he was being grilled, he called out to those torturing him and said, ” Turn me over I’m done on this side!”. For me, San Lorenzo is the patron Saint of my…

Judy Witts Francini

Originally from California; Tuscany has been my home since 1984. I found the city of Florence to hold all my passions, food, wine, art all in one place. When I am not in Tuscany, I am often found in Sicily, my other favorite place to be. Always searching for recipes to share and exploring for the guides I write to my favorite cities for food and wine.
